										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p data-start="2826" data-end="3083">In the ever-evolving world of crypto, not all projects can keep up with industry standards. Investors woke up to a significant announcement this week as <strong data-start="2979" data-end="2990">Binance</strong>, the world’s largest crypto exchange, revealed it will delist five tokens from its platform.</p>
<p data-start="3085" data-end="3222">Such decisions don’t just impact the listed projects — they also send ripples through the portfolios of thousands of investors worldwide.</p>
<h2 data-start="3224" data-end="3266">Which Tokens Are Affected and Why?</h2>
<p data-start="3268" data-end="3411">According to <span style="color: #0000ff;"><a style="color: #0000ff;" href="https://coinengineer.net/blog/?s=binance"><strong>Binance</strong></a></span>’s official statement, the following tokens will be delisted from all spot trading pairs on July 4, 2025, at 03:00 UTC:</p>
<ul>
<li data-start="3415" data-end="3435"><strong data-start="3415" data-end="3433">ALPHA (Stella)</strong></li>
<li data-start="3438" data-end="3456"><strong data-start="3438" data-end="3454">BSW (Biswap)</strong></li>
<li data-start="3459" data-end="3477"><strong data-start="3459" data-end="3475">KMD (Komodo)</strong></li>
<li data-start="3480" data-end="3501"><strong data-start="3480" data-end="3499">LEVER (LeverFi)</strong></li>
<li data-start="3504" data-end="3525"><strong data-start="3504" data-end="3525">LTO (LTO Network)</strong></li>
</ul>
<p data-start="3527" data-end="3795">The delisting decision was based on several criteria, including development activity, community engagement, regulatory alignment, and liquidity. <strong>Binance</strong> emphasized that maintaining high-quality listings is essential to protecting users and ensuring platform integrity.</p>

<h2 data-start="3797" data-end="3839">What Investors Need To Know and Do</h2>
<p data-start="3841" data-end="4078">The impact extends beyond spot trading. Margin trading, loans, staking (Simple Earn), gift cards, convert features, and buy/sell crypto services related to these tokens will also be phased out on different dates leading up to July 4.</p>
<p data-start="4080" data-end="4108">Important timelines include:</p>
<ul>
<li data-start="4112" data-end="4171"><strong data-start="4112" data-end="4128">July 2, 2025</strong> – Suspension of margin and loan services</li>
<li data-start="4174" data-end="4252"><strong data-start="4174" data-end="4190">July 3, 2025</strong> – Final Simple Earn redemption and Convert platform changes</li>
<li data-start="4255" data-end="4307"><strong data-start="4255" data-end="4271">July 4, 2025</strong> – Complete spot trading delisting</li>
<li data-start="4310" data-end="4372"><strong data-start="4310" data-end="4331">September 3, 2025</strong> – Last day to withdraw affected tokens</li>
</ul>
<p data-start="4374" data-end="4484">After September 4, Binance may convert remaining balances into stablecoins, though this is not guaranteed.</p>
<p data-start="4486" data-end="4516">Users are strongly advised to:</p>
<ul>
<li data-start="4520" data-end="4546">Cancel all active orders</li>
<li data-start="4549" data-end="4585">Repay any outstanding margin loans</li>
<li data-start="4588" data-end="4630">Withdraw or convert their balances in time</li>
</ul>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Over the past week, <strong>LeverFi (LEVER)</strong> has seen a positive movement; technical indications point to a strong buy recommendation. LEVER has promise for ongoing expansion as optimistic momentum develops. Diving into the technical indicators, moving averages, and financial performance, this weekly study offers a complete picture of the token&#8217;s present market situation.</p>
<h3>Technical Indicators: Strong Buy</h3>
<p>LeverFi&#8217;s technical indicators show a positive picture: six buy signals and four neutral ratings. Let us dissect some of the main indicators causing this attitude:</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>RSI (14):</strong> At 49.554, the Relative Strength Index (RSI) is in neutral territory, indicating that the token is not overbought or oversold. This reflects balanced buying and selling activity in the market.</li>
<li><strong>Stochastic Oscillator (9,6):</strong> With a value of 64.545, this oscillator signals a &#8220;Buy,&#8221; suggesting that the momentum is in favor of buyers, potentially driving the price upward in the short term.</li>
<li><strong>MACD (12,26):</strong> The MACD shows a neutral value of 0, indicating that there’s no immediate signal for significant price movement, although it suggests that the token is in a steady phase.</li>
<li><strong>ADX (14):</strong> At 25.181, the Average Directional Index (ADX) signals a buy, suggesting that the current upward trend is gaining strength.</li>
<li><strong>Williams %R:</strong> This indicator shows a value of -29.508, also indicating a buy, which suggests that LEVER is currently gaining momentum without being overbought.</li>
</ul>
<p>The technical indications show a solid buy overall; momentum indicators hint to more price increases.</p>
<h3>Moving Averages: Bullish Outlook</h3>
<p>With 11 purchase indications and just one sell signal across both short- and long-term moving averages, LeverFi&#8217;s moving averages give the positive mood even more weight.</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>MA5 &amp; MA10:</strong> The 5-day and 10-day simple and exponential moving averages both indicate buy signals, suggesting that short-term momentum is on the rise. This implies that traders looking for quick gains may find opportunities in LEVER’s current market setup.</li>
<li><strong>MA50, MA100, &amp; MA200:</strong> Longer-term moving averages, such as the 50-day and 100-day MA, show consistent buy signals, indicating a sustained upward trend for LeverFi. These buy signals confirm that LEVER is currently outperforming and may continue its bullish momentum over the longer term.</li>
</ul>
<p>This moving average data supports the idea that <strong>LeverFi</strong> is poised for continued growth, both in the short and long term.</p>
<h3>Market Performance and Financials</h3>
<p>With a 4.54% rise in its market capitalization—now at $75.95 million—<strong>LeverFi</strong> has shown good financial performance. A notable increase in 24-hour trading volume of 138.30% to $14.54 million points even more to LEVER&#8217;s increasing attraction to traders.</p>
<p>With a lot of the market capital of the token actively traded, the volume-to-market cap ratio of 19.06% points to good trading activity. Those seeking chances to enter or leave the market may find this liquidity helpful.</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Circulating Supply:</strong> With 95.12% of the total supply already in circulation (33.29 billion out of 35 billion), the token’s supply dynamics are stable, reducing the risk of inflationary pressures in the market.<br />
<strong>Price:</strong> LEVER’s current price of $0.002283 represents a modest value, but with strong buy signals and growing trading volumes, there is room for price appreciation in the coming days.</li>
</ul>
